ECAP Process in Polypropylene

open access: yesJournal of the Society of Materials Science, Japan, 2006
Equal channel angular pressing (ECAP) invented by Segal was applied successfully to metal process of aluminum and magnesium alloys for increasing their strength by fining the grain size. But a little attention has been paid to its application to polymers.

Gas–liquid mass transfer enhancement in the presence of nanoparticles under slug flow in microreactors

open access: yesAIChE Journal, EarlyView.
Abstract Nanofluids containing nanoparticles represent a promising solvent or reaction system for gas–liquid operations. Herein, the effect of nanoparticle (Al2O3 and SiO2) addition on gas–liquid slug flow pattern and mass transfer enhancement was investigated during CO2 absorption into water in microreactors.
